Step 1 of restructuring: libmandoc.h.  Move all compiler-set-specific
stuff into libmandoc.h, including old mdoc.h/man.h/roff.h functions now
used by read.c.  The motivation behind this is to tighten the
relationship between the underlying compilers while keeping parse data
hidden from general callers (e.g., main.c).

While here, also move register values from mandoc.h into libmandoc.h as
noted by schwarze@.  See above for explanation.

#include <assert.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<time.h>

#include "mandoc.h"
#include "libmandoc.h"
#include "libroff.h"

enum rofferr
tbl_read(struct tbl_node *tbl, int ln, const char *p, int offs)
{
	int		 len;
	const char	*cp;

	cp = &p[offs];
	len = (int)strlen(cp);

	/*
	 * If we're in the options section and we don't have a
	 * terminating semicolon, assume we've moved directly into the
	 * layout section.  No need to report a warning: this is,
	 * apparently, standard behaviour.
	 */

	if (TBL_PART_OPTS == tbl->part && len)
		if (';' != cp[len - 1])
			tbl->part = TBL_PART_LAYOUT;

	/* Now process each logical section of the table.  */

	switch (tbl->part) {
	case (TBL_PART_OPTS):
		return(tbl_option(tbl, ln, p) ? ROFF_IGN : ROFF_ERR);
	case (TBL_PART_LAYOUT):
		return(tbl_layout(tbl, ln, p) ? ROFF_IGN : ROFF_ERR);
	case (TBL_PART_CDATA):
		return(tbl_cdata(tbl, ln, p) ? ROFF_TBL : ROFF_IGN);
	default:
		break;
	}

	/*
	 * This only returns zero if the line is empty, so we ignore it
	 * and continue on.
	 */
	return(tbl_data(tbl, ln, p) ? ROFF_TBL : ROFF_IGN);
}

struct tbl_node *
tbl_alloc(int pos, int line, struct mparse *parse)
{
	struct tbl_node	*p;

	p = mandoc_calloc(1, sizeof(struct tbl_node));
	p->line = line;
	p->pos = pos;
	p->parse = parse;
	p->part = TBL_PART_OPTS;
	p->opts.tab = '\t';
	p->opts.linesize = 12;
	p->opts.decimal = '.';
	return(p);
}

void
tbl_free(struct tbl_node *p)
{
	struct tbl_row	*rp;
	struct tbl_cell	*cp;
	struct tbl_span	*sp;
	struct tbl_dat	*dp;
	struct tbl_head	*hp;

	while (NULL != (rp = p->first_row)) {
		p->first_row = rp->next;
		while (rp->first) {
			cp = rp->first;
			rp->first = cp->next;
			free(cp);
		}
		free(rp);
	}

	while (NULL != (sp = p->first_span)) {
		p->first_span = sp->next;
		while (sp->first) {
			dp = sp->first;
			sp->first = dp->next;
			if (dp->string)
				free(dp->string);
			free(dp);
		}
		free(sp);
	}

	while (NULL != (hp = p->first_head)) {
		p->first_head = hp->next;
		free(hp);
	}

	free(p);
}

void
tbl_restart(int line, int pos, struct tbl_node *tbl)
{
	if (TBL_PART_CDATA == tbl->part)
		mandoc_msg(MANDOCERR_TBLBLOCK, tbl->parse, 
				tbl->line, tbl->pos, NULL);

	tbl->part = TBL_PART_LAYOUT;
	tbl->line = line;
	tbl->pos = pos;

	if (NULL == tbl->first_span || NULL == tbl->first_span->first)
		mandoc_msg(MANDOCERR_TBLNODATA, tbl->parse,
				tbl->line, tbl->pos, NULL);
}

const struct tbl_span *
tbl_span(struct tbl_node *tbl)
{
	struct tbl_span	 *span;

	assert(tbl);
	span = tbl->current_span ? tbl->current_span->next
				 : tbl->first_span;
	if (span)
		tbl->current_span = span;
	return(span);
}

void
tbl_end(struct tbl_node *tbl)
{

	if (NULL == tbl->first_span || NULL == tbl->first_span->first)
		mandoc_msg(MANDOCERR_TBLNODATA, tbl->parse, 
				tbl->line, tbl->pos, NULL);

	if (tbl->last_span)
		tbl->last_span->flags |= TBL_SPAN_LAST;

	if (TBL_PART_CDATA == tbl->part)
		mandoc_msg(MANDOCERR_TBLBLOCK, tbl->parse, 
				tbl->line, tbl->pos, NULL);
}
